The Clapham Junction railway crash occurred on the morning of 12 December 1988, when a crowded British Rail passenger train crashed into the rear of another train that had stopped at a signal just south of Clapham Junction railway station in London, England, and subsequently sideswiped an empty train travelling in the opposite direction.A total of 35 people died in the collision, while 484 . Under the Grade Crossings Regulations (the Regulations) effective in November of 2014, railway companies, and public and private authorities share the responsibility for managing the safety at federally-regulated grade crossings.
